docker安装rabbitmq和redis详解

本文介绍如何使用Docker快速安装并配置RabbitMQ消息队列和Redis数据库服务。包括选择镜像版本、拉取镜像、配置参数及启动容器等步骤。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

一、docker安装rabbitmq

1,登录docker镜像源,选择一个合适rabbit镜像版本下载

Docker Hub[这里是图片001]https://hub.docker.com/_/rabbitmq?tab=tags

2,拉取镜像

docker pull rabbitmq:latest

3,创建一个文件夹,用于挂载rabbitmq容器数据

mkdir /home/my-rabbitmq

4,启动容器

docker run -d --name rabbit --hostname myRabbit -p 5672:5672 -p 15672:15672 -v /home/my-rabbitmq:/var/lib/rabbitmq rabbitmq

5,进入容器,执行下面命令

docker exec -it b19950aae8d0 /bin/bash

rabbitmq-plugins enable rabbitmq_management

6,退出容器,访问一下rabbitmq web界面,登录用户名和密码默认都是guest,安装完成

http://IP:15672

二、docker安装redis

1,进入docker镜像源web页面,选择一个合适的redis镜像版本下载

Docker Hub[这里是图片004]https://hub.docker.com/_/redis?tab=tags2,拉取redis镜像

docker pull redis:latest

3,进入redis中文官方网站http://www.redis.cn/download.html

4,下载一个redis包,主要是拿包里的配置文件

5,解压reids包,把redis.conf配置文件上传到服务器上

6,修改redis.conf配置文件

bind 127.0.0.1 #注释掉这部分,使redis可以外部访问
daemonize no#用守护线程的方式启动
requirepass 你的密码#给redis设置密码
appendonly yes#redis持久化  默认是no
tcp-keepalive 300 #防止出现远程主机强迫关闭了一个现有的连接的错误 默认是300

7,创建一个文件夹用于挂载redis容器数据

mkdir /home/my-redis

8,把配置文件拷贝进去

cp**redis.conf?**/home/my-redis

9,启动redis容器

docker run -p 6379:6379 --name redis -v /home/my-redis/redis.conf:/etc/redis/redis.conf -v /home/my-redis/data:/data -d redis redis-server /etc/redis/redis.conf --appendonly yes

10,安装完成,检查一下redis容器启动情况

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值